For some unknown reason, within the last few days--this block *which is connected with DarkSky* map is only black and white with NO information. If I go to the DarkSky website? Same thing. Is anyone else seeing this behavior on their end, and if so, any information to share on what it is and how to workaround or repair? I have temporarily removed it from my webpage until some sort of additional information is shared.
I have checked my DarkSky API and all is well there, and of course, that would not explain the website issues. I also have tried using 2 different browsers *to rule out browser settings* and same results. I am also seeing it on the BRNO testwebsite so it appears to indeed be a Darksky.net issue.
Screen shots of my home page AND Darksky.net page illustrating the issues I am describing. I am beginning to think it is a DARKSKY issue and have contacted them for more information. I will update this post to reflect their response if I receive one.
